**Fig leaf absolute** | **Fig leaf absolute** | ||
- | The leaves of Ficus carica are extracted with solvent to obtain a concrete, which is subsequent treated with alcohol. The residue represents a dark green to brownish green viscous liquid of a sweet, green, herbaceous, somewhat woody odor with a mossy undertone. "Based on sensitization reactions at 5% and strong phototoxic reactions, the Panel concluded that the material should be banned. A RIFM Advisory Letter (RIFM, 1980) was issued to all members stating the potential for induction of skin and phototoxic reactions.
